Meet the Brachial Plexus and Peripheral Nerve Program Team

Children and babies with peripheral nerve and brachial plexus disorders benefit from a multidisciplinary approach that brings together a team of specialists to participate in evaluation and treatment.

The Nicklaus Children's Peripheral Nerve and Brachial Plexus Disorders Program team includes the following specialists:
